This video provides a first look at the Sig Sauer P320 X5 Coyote pistol. The reviewer highlights several key features that make it a strong out-of-the-box option, including its flat-faced trigger, 21-round factory magazines, and forward slide serrations. Due to the lack of a specific holster, a Surefire X300 Ultra light was attached, allowing the pistol to be used with a Phlster Floodlight Holster. The Mossberg MC1 is a new single-stack 9mm pistol designed to compete with the Glock 43, notably accepting Glock 43 magazines. It features a 3.4-inch barrel, Sig-compatible sights, aggressive texturing, and a flat-face trigger with a 6-pound pull. A 5,000-round reliability test showed no failures, indicating strong out-of-the-box dependability. Mossberg offers multiple variations, including models with night sights and lasers.
The Smith & Wesson M&P Shield 2.0 offers a significant upgrade over the 1.0, featuring a more aggressive grip texture, a crisper 6.5 lb trigger, and improved Armornite finish. While dimensions are comparable to the Glock 43, the Shield 2.0 provides a secure hold and good ergonomics for concealed carry and self-defense. Potential buyers should be aware of possible factory sight misalignment issues.
This video covers the new Remington RP9, a 9mm striker-fired pistol introduced at Shot Show 2017. Key features highlighted include its 18-round capacity, modular design, fully ambidextrous controls, forward slide serrations, and an undercut trigger for improved grip.
